Economy & Government

The Frozen Empire of Four Hectares is a massive, arctic nation, a champion of modern capitalism and serves as a global economic role model. Legislating from the capital city, Brutus, the democratic government assumes a mostly conservative stance in modern politics and its citzens are afforded a modest amount of civil and political freedoms. It's economy is highly open and free-market, which allows the nation to consistently achieve high economic ratings, extremely low rates of full employment (less than 3%) and a GDP per capita above $40,000/year. It's national animal is the elephant, which is strange considering that no elephant could possibly survive in the brutally cold, arctic conditions which characterize the nation's climate. It's currency is the regional WW$ETI.

History

The Frozen Empire of Four Hectares was born on December 28, 1961 when the national Constitution was signed on a bitterly cold, snowy morning (-42F) in the nation's newly proclaimed capital, Brutus.

The history of the region goes back almost 150 years, when the West Pacific explorer, Captain Roland, first landed on the eastern shores of what would eventually come to be called the WWSETI region. He soon fell in love with the region's enviornmental diversity and it's native people and eventually gave up his very lucrative sailing career to settle there, becoming the region's first leader. Captain Roland's discovery attracted people of every color, race and creed from all over the NS World, thanks to a very savvy advertising campaign and a series of horrific wars between other regions. By 1955, all but the vast northernmost reaches of the region's land had been explored and mapped and the region was an economic and democratic success. It was assumed that the arctic regions were completely uninhabitable, due to extremely cold temperatures, permafrost and harsh blizzards, 9 months out of the year.

At this point, we enter the world of James F. Gigler. A young and eager explorer from the North Pacific region, Gigler was attracted to the WWSETI's northernmost reaches because of their sheer size, not to mention that he had a controlling stake in several ski resorts back in the North Pacific and the area had a vast mountain range running right through it. He told President Roland of the Hagge nation that he intended to explore and properly map the region, as well as found a nation there.
